Spend A Penny
5/1/2010
American casino and gaming operator Penn National Gaming have just completed the purchase of a 44-acre site in Toledo, Ohio.
The Miami Street site is set to be transformed into a mega gambling complex which will cost an estimated $250 million. Under the state’s new constitutional vote Toledo is now permitted another gaming license which means the new Hollywood Casino is one step closer to becoming a reality. Eric Shippers, senior vice president of Penn National Gaming, commented after the purchase: "Closing on the property moves us a major step closer to making Hollywood Casino Toledo a reality.
We're eager to move forward and excited that this project will bring thousands of construction and permanent jobs to the Toledo area, as well as tens of millions of dollars for the city of Toledo as well as all of the counties and school districts in north-west Ohio."
This latest move will no doubt come as a welcome boost to the state as the revenue a new casino can generate will help pull the local economy out of its current slump. Indeed, with gambling revenue on the increase, not only in America but across the world, it seems as though Penn National’s major new plans are coming to fruition just at the right time.
